Karen Burniston used to design for Sizzix and Elizabeth Craft, she opened her own die company about 3 years ago. She has blown all of her old designs OUT OF THE WATER since she is able to do what she AND her customers want her to do!
Karen and her Design Team have challenges ALL the time. This blog has links to videos showing how to use the dies to make the cards. She is a great teacher, some companies make popup or interactive dies and leave YOU to figure it out! Not Karen, there are directions for the dies ON the package, more involved printable directions on her website and videos on YouTube SHOWING you how to do them. The blog has links to videos and shows all the design team's version of cards.
This FaceBook page is where Karen and her designers post cards. There is a link on there for Karen's Popup Peeps, it is a closed FB group where the general public ALSO posts our versions of Karen's cards. If you have ANY questions, ask there (after you ask to join) and just about any time, day or night, there will be SOMEONE there to help you!
